Пример 7. Ввести массив А из 10 элементов. Найти произведение элементов массива.
Sub primer_3()
Dim A(10) As Integer
Dim Р As Integer
For i = 1 To 10
A(i) = Cells(1, i)
Next i
Р = 1
For i = 1 To 10
Р = Р * A(i)
Next i
Cells(4, 1) = "Произведение элементов массива =" & Р
'вывод произведения в 4 строку 1 столбец активного листа Excel
End Sub
Результат программы:
Пример 8. Ввести массив А из 10 элементов. Найти максимальный элемент массива.
В этом примере переменная MAX используется для запоминания текущего максимального элемента с обновлением – в случае необходимости – по мере перебора всех элементов.
Sub primer_4()
Dim A(8) As Integer
For i = 1 To 8
A(i) = Cells(1, i)
Next i
MAX = A(1)
For i = 2 To 8
If A(i) > MAX Then MAX = A(i)
Next i
MsgBox "Максимальный элемент массива = " & MAX,, "Решение задачи"
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ет
stud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ав!Последнее добавление